"A stunning rendition of the variety, showing Black Doris plum, blueberry, violet, cedar and warm spice aromas, leading to a concentrated palate delivering terrific fruit power with plush texture and layers of fine-grained tannins. Wonderfully composed with awesome fruit purity and stylish complexity. At its best: 2024 to 2038" Sam Kim, Wine Orbit, Apr 2023

"Fantastic bouquet and palate - a concentration of colour and intensity, dark berry fruits and smoky oak qualities. On the palate a wine of equal allure with a firm polished palate showcasing dark plums and black cherry flavours, clove and cinnamon oak, firm tannins and a back bone of acidity. Plush, lengthy a touch of peppery spice with a complex and intense flavour package. Great drinking from 2023 through 2030" Cameron Douglas, Master Sommelier, May 2023

"Intense, ripe, youthful red with plum, dark berry, cassis, cedar, black pepper and spicy oak flavours. Impressive weight and concentration that suggests a promising future although it is just a little closed right now" Bob Campbell, Master of Wine, Real Review, May 2023

This rich and seductive Syrah is a blend of parcels from our vineyards in Hawkes Bays Gimblett Gravels sub-region. 2021 delivered Syrah packed full of trademark dark fruit and spice. Dense purple hues lead to a perfumed nose of blueberries, violet and subtle black pepper. Ripe tannins encase concentrated fruit on a long and silky palate framed by juicy acidity. Careful cellaring of up to 10+ years will add further complexity.

2021 will be remembered as a great Hawkes Bay vintage. A hot dry summer ensured good ripeness with cooler night-time temperatures keeping freshness in the grapes. A settled Autumn ensured fruit was harvested in excellent condition.

Villa Maria’s Reserve Syrah vineyards are located in the Gimblett Gravels of Hawkes Bay. The free-draining soils, warm daytime temperatues and cool nights encourage naturally devigourated vines to ripen their low yields slowly and evenly. These factors, along with well-timed vineyard management techniques ensure the resulting wines are deeply coloured and well structured, with pure aromatics and flavours classic to the variety.
